During ascent, an airplane cabin loses atmospheric pressure. The air inside the middle ear expands, pushing against the eardrum. Normally, this excess air escapes through the Eustachian tube easily, often without the passenger noticing.

For Babies and Children Bottle or pacifier : The sucking motion helps them pop. Breastfeed : Keep them swallowing during altitude changes. Avoid sleeping : Wake them up before the descent begins. When to See a Doctor Severe pain : If pain lasts hours after landing. Hearing loss : Any muffled hearing that doesn't clear. Fluid drainage : If you notice liquid or blood.
